John Lewis Packaging

I reimagined John Lewis’ packaging to produce a ‘wow’ factor for the customer when they tear off the tag and the sides of the packaging fall away to reveal the product. 
 
At the moment their home delivery system uses standard cardboard boxes with plastic air bags to protect the product which isn’t very environmentally friendly.
 
In order to protect the product in a neat and environmentally sustainable way I created a corrugated cardboard protection system which easily moulds to the shape and size of the product in the factory.
Adding joy to user experiences is what I am becoming increasingly interested in as a designer and I am continuing with the idea of very joyous experiences in new projects also.
